Abstract
The present invention is related to an illumination device capable of producing ambient light and whose structure can be efficiently manufactured and assembled. The illumination device comprises: a substrate electrically connect to a power supply, a plurality of light sources attached to a surface of the substrate, a reflection body with a reflection surface situated a distance from said plurality of light sources, a shell having a diffusion surface situated a distance from said reflection surface. The illumination device may further comprise a housing for receiving and supporting the substrate and the reflection body. The housing is configured to join with the shell and can be further attached to an external device receiving the ambient light. The light emitted from the light sources is reflected by the reflection body to the diffusion member and then radiates outwardly to the surrounding environment of the shell. The reflection surface of the reflection body is inclined at angle relative to the substrate. Said reflection angle formed by the reflection surface and the substrate can be adjusted so that the light is effectively reflected by the reflection surface to the surrounding environment of the device.
